Ingredients
  

12 oz cheese tortellini (fresh or frozen)

1 lb ground beef (or turkey for a lighter option)

1 small onion, diced

2 cloves garlic, minced

1 packet taco seasoning

1 can (15 oz) diced tomatoes with green chilies

1 cup chicken broth

1 cup corn (canned or frozen)

1 cup black beans, rinsed and drained

1 cup shredded cheddar cheese

1/2 cup sour cream

Fresh cilantro, chopped (for garnish)

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ions
 

In a large pot over medium heat, add the ground beef (or turkey) and cook until browned, breaking it apart with a spatula. Drain excess fat if necessary.

    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the pot. Sauté for about 3-4 minutes, until the onion becomes translucent and fragrant.

      Sprinkle the taco seasoning over the meat mixture and stir well to combine, cooking for another 1-2 minutes.

        Pour in the diced tomatoes (including juices), chicken broth, corn, and black beans. Stir to mix everything together.

          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ce to a simmer and add the tortellini. Cover the pot and cook for about 8-10 minutes, or until the tortellini is cooked through, stirring occasionally.

            Once the tortellini is tender, remove the pot from heat and stir in the shredded cheddar cheese until melted.

              Lastly, mix in the sour cream, adjusting the quantity to your liking, to create a creamy texture. Season with salt and pepper as needed.

                Serve hot, garnished with chopped fresh cilantro for an extra burst of flavor!

                  Prep Time: 10 mins | Total Time: 30 mins | Servings: 4
